Bathrooms to splash out on. Julia Dawson reports on recent innovations.


501 SWAROVSKI

Swarovski, world leader in cut crystal, has collaborated with German bathroom fittings company Kludi to come up with the luxury Dazzling Daydream bathroom. The world of the bathroom seemed a logical step for the crystal company to take: Swarovski think of crystal as the teardrops of the goddesses and water seemed a natural partner to their crystal. The bathroom is intended to embody dream and reality, the crystal enhancing the interplay of light and water. The Dazzling Daydream project resulted in two model bathrooms: the darker more masculine Passion (above) made up of granite, limestone, ceramic, crystal, glass and chrome; and Delight (shower fitting right), translucent and bright in limestone, crystal, glass, wood and chrome. The designs combine asymmetrical shower enclosures with sleek angular basins, lavatories and taps. The bathrooms come in three varieties, compact, regular and complex, according to according to

502 HANSGROHE

Nature Inspired Design is the concept behind Jean-Marie Massaud's design for the Axor Hansgrohe bathroom collection unveiled at the Milan Furniture Fair this month.

504 DORNBRACHT

Dornbracht has introduced four new rain panel solutions for both private bathrooms and hotel use, 'transferring the culture of rain from nature to architecture'. The latest shower, RainSky E (shown left), measures 1020 x 820mm and incorporates head spray, body spray Body spray is a perfume product which is lighter in strength than cologne, generally less expensive, and doubles as a deodorant.[1] Some well known body spray brands include Unilever's "Axe", Gillette's "Tag", Dial's "RGX", Procter & Gamble's "Old Spice Body Spray", and A.  and rain curtain, two light strips, a mist projector and aroma sprays, all regulated by a stainless steel stainless steel: see steel.

506 BOFFI

Designed by Japanese designer Naoto Fukasawa Born in Yamanashi Prefecture in 1956. Graduated from Tama Art University in 1980. After having acted as the head of the American company IDEO's Tokyo office, he established Naoto Fukasawa Design in 2003.  for Boffi, this elegant bath is cast moulded for a particularly seamless appearance. Water is laterally supplied, mimicking the flow of a waterfall.
